An example of procedural justice in the courtroom would be as simple as providing an interpreter to someone appearing at traffic court if English was not their first language. This way, regardless of the outcome of their traffic case, the persons experience in court will be more respectful and fair.

Ever since the publication of his seminal 1996 book, The Future of Law , Richard Susskind has remained the world’s most-recognized and most-respected speaker and author on the future of legal services. But even he could not have foreseen the sudden relevance of his latest book, Online Courts and the Future of Justice.
This emerging discipline is rapidly gaining steam as law firms, legal departments, courts, and even legislators recognize its benefits. Courts and government leverage legal design to make the justice system more accessible to citizens. Examples include online disputeresolution systems and redesigned court forms.
